My father and I are doing a custom MS80 gas pump for a client. He wanted an ad glass top but none were available so we are converting a tall MS80 top into the glass version. I had to make two plates per side, one to give depth for the glass the other to hold the gasket for the lens. The plates were made on a plasma CNC machine.

Some welding and cutting required but coming out pretty nice so far. Will show some pictures when all done. I made the lenses fit just slightly looser than the original ones do, always thought installing the original lenses was a pain in the butt!

I may make some more plates sometime, I want to modify the design based on what we learned from this go around. The curve inside the top I didn't compensate enough for on this design so we had to do some grinding.
